Types of Collision Damage We Evaluate
Our team at this collision center serving North Dallas evaluates various accident scenarios that vehicles experience daily:
- Structural Frame Damage: Compromised frame integrity can affect vehicle handling. We use modern technology to assess structural issues thoroughly.
- Bumper and Fascia Damage: Broken fascia components are among the frequent damage types. These exterior components often hide additional issues.
- Paint and Body Panel Damage: Scratched paint require professional refinishing. Our certified professionals in Wylie can evaluate paint depth with precision.
- Mechanical and Electrical Damage: Electrical wiring may sustain internal injuries during collisions. A comprehensive vehicle damage assessment ensures complete transparency.
- Safety System Damage: Modern vehicles rely on electronic stability controls. Our certified technicians verify that all safety mechanisms function properly.
The Collision Damage Estimate Process
When you bring your vehicle to our neighborhood repair facility, we follow a comprehensive evaluation process to provide accurate damage estimates. Located near local commercial districts, we're easily accessible for residents throughout the community.
Our collision damage estimate process includes:
- First-stage evaluation of obvious impact areas
- Computer-based analysis to identify hidden issues
- Detailed record-keeping for insurance purposes
- Transparent communication of necessary procedures
- Formal damage assessment covering necessary repairs
